MySQL安装:快速获取账户密码指南

资源类型:iis7.vip 2025-06-21 00:14

mysql安装提示账户密码简介:



MySQL安装与账户密码设置的权威指南 在当今的数据驱动时代,MySQL作为一款开源的关系型数据库管理系统(RDBMS),凭借其高性能、可靠性和易用性,成为了众多开发者和企业的首选

    无论是搭建网站后台、进行数据分析,还是构建复杂的应用系统,MySQL都能提供强大的支持

    然而,对于初学者或初次部署MySQL的用户来说,安装过程中的账户密码设置往往是一个令人困惑的环节

    本文将以权威且详尽的方式,指导您完成MySQL的安装,并正确设置账户密码,确保您的数据库系统既安全又高效

     一、MySQL安装前的准备工作 在正式安装MySQL之前,做好充分的准备工作至关重要

    这包括: 1.系统环境检查:确认您的操作系统版本与MySQL的兼容性

    MySQL支持多种操作系统,包括Windows、Linux、macOS等,但不同版本可能有所差异

     2.软件依赖安装:对于Linux用户,可能需要先安装一些必要的依赖包,如libaio、numactl等,这些可以通过包管理器(如yum或apt)进行安装

     3.下载MySQL安装包:访问MySQL官方网站下载最新稳定版的安装包

    根据您的操作系统选择对应的版本,可以是二进制包、源码包或通过包管理器直接安装

     4.规划安装路径:决定MySQL的安装目录和数据存储目录,合理规划磁盘空间,以避免未来因空间不足导致的问题

     二、MySQL的安装步骤 Windows系统安装指南 1.运行安装程序:双击下载的安装包,启动安装向导

     2.选择安装类型:通常建议选择“Developer Default”或“Server only”安装类型,以满足大多数开发或生产环境的需求

     3.配置MySQL Server:在安装过程中,会出现一个配置向导,用于设置MySQL的root账户密码、选择字符集、配置InnoDB等

    请务必牢记设置的root密码,这是管理MySQL数据库的关键

     4.执行安装:根据提示完成安装过程,期间可能会要求重启计算机以应用更改

     Linux系统安装指南(以Ubuntu为例) 1.更新包列表:打开终端,执行`sudo apt update`命令

     2.安装MySQL Server:运行`sudo apt install mysql-server`命令开始安装

     3.配置MySQL:安装完成后,系统会自动运行`mysql_secure_installation`脚本,引导您设置root密码、移除匿名用户、禁止root远程登录、删除测试数据库等安全配置

    请按照提示操作,确保每一步都正确无误

     4.启动MySQL服务:使用`sudo systemctl start mysql`命令启动MySQL服务,并设置开机自启`sudo systemctl enable mysql`

     三、设置与管理MySQL账户密码 初始密码设置 在安装MySQL时,无论是Windows还是Linux,都会有一个设置root账户密码的环节

    这个密码是访问MySQL数据库的最高权限凭证,务必妥善保管

    若安装过程中未设置或遗忘密码,可通过特定的恢复方法重置,但这通常涉及复杂的操作步骤,甚至可能影响到数据库数据的安全性

     修改密码 随着使用时间的推移,出于安全考虑,您可能需要定期修改MySQL账户密码

    这可以通过以下步骤实现: 1.登录MySQL:使用`mysql -u root -p`命令,输入当前密码登录

     2.修改密码:在MySQL命令行界面,执行`ALTER USER root@localhost IDENTIFIED BY 新密码;`命令来修改密码

    注意,MySQL5.7及以上版本要求使用`ALTER USER`语句修改密码,而旧版本则可能使用`SET PASSWORD`命令

     3.刷新权限:执行`FLUSH PRIVILEGES;`命令,确保权限更改立即生效

     创建与管理用户账户 除了root账户外,为了更精细地控制数据库访问权限,通常还会创建其他用户账户

     1.创建新用户:使用`CREATE USER 用户名@主机名 IDENTIFIED BY 密码;`命令创建新用户

    这里的“用户名”和“主机名”共同定义了用户的访问权限范围

     2.授予权限:通过GRANT语句为新用户分配特定的数据库操作权限,如`GRANT ALL PRIVILEGES ON 数据库名- . TO 用户名@主机名;`

    务必遵循最小权限原则,仅授予用户完成其任务所需的最小权限集

     3.查看用户权限:使用`SHOW GRANTS FOR 用户名@主机名;`命令查看用户的当前权限配置

     4.删除用户:若用户不再需要访问数据库,可通过`DROP USER 用户名@主机名;`命令删除

     四、安全最佳实践 在设置和管理MySQL账户密码时,遵循以下安全最佳实践至关重要: -使用强密码:确保密码包含大小写字母、数字和特殊字符的组合,长度不少于8位

     -定期更换密码:制定密码更换策略,定期(如每季度)更新账户密码

     -避免使用root账户进行日常操作:创建具有特定权限的用户账户进行日常数据库管理,减少root账户的使用频率

     -启用日志审计:开启MySQL的查询日志、慢查询日志等,以便追踪和分析数据库访问行为,及时发现潜在的安全风险

     -定期审查用户权限:定期检查数据库中的用户账户及其权限配置,确保没有不必要的账户存在,且所有账户的权限都是最低必要权限

     五、结论 MySQL的安装与账户密码设置是构建安全、高效数据库系统的基石

    通过本文的详细指导,您不仅学会了如何在不同操作系统上安装MySQL,还掌握了设置和管理账户密码的关键技能

    遵循安全最佳实践,您将能够构建一个既满足业务需求又安全可靠的数据库环境

    记住,数据库安全无小事,任何疏忽都可能带来不可估量的损失

    因此,始终保持警惕,不断提升自己的数据库安全管理能力,是每一位数据库管理员的必修课

    

阅读全文
上一篇:创建MySQL数据库,设置字符集指南

最新收录:

  • MySQL中的延迟函数应用:提升数据处理灵活性
  • 创建MySQL数据库,设置字符集指南
  • MySQL端口必须是3306吗?解析来了!
  • MySQL X 协议:解锁数据库新能力
  • 如何高效创建MySQL数据库的新增维护计划
  • MySQL分割字符串,统计词频标题
  • MySQL模拟并发测试实操指南
  • MySQL常用语句库:必备SQL技巧汇总
  • apecloud-mysql:高效云数据库管理解决方案揭秘
  • 首次登录MySQL的默认密码是多少
  • 精通MySQL:深入浅出数据库开发指南
  • MySQL SQL技巧:轻松去重值
  • 首页 | mysql安装提示账户密码:MySQL安装:快速获取账户密码指南